The Purge: Election Year Cast & Character Guide

The Purge: Election Year is one of 2016’s biggest horror movies, bringing a compelling cast to the long-running dystopian genre franchise. The Purge franchise began in 2013, offering a combination of horror, action, and light political commentary. The third film, Election Year, is often considered one of the best Purge movies, expanding on the lore by examining how the ruling class views Purge night. With the year’s real-world election occurring just months later, the film made a concerted effort to explore timely themes regarding American life.

While the film was released in 2016, Election Year actually occurs much later on The Purge timeline, set in a dystopian future during the year 2040. With decades since the first Purge occurred, the existence of the annual bloodbath is a central political topic for the movie’s fictional election. This allows characters from The Purge: Anarchy to return, including star Frank Grillo as the lead. However, much of the cast is fresh to the movie, meaning new faces for viewers to familiarize themselves with. James DeMonaco also returned to write and direct the film.

Frank Grillo as Leo Barnes

Born June 8, 1965

  • Active Since: 1992

Actor: Frank Grillo has played starring and supporting roles in movies and TV shows since his first role in the 1992 film The Mambo Kings. With a background in martial arts, Grillo has found a niche in physical roles, including several action movies, including The Purge franchise, Zero Dark Thirty, Minority Report, and many others. He’s appeared as a villain in the MCU’s Captain America films and will soon be starring in the DCU as Rick Flag Sr. He’s already voiced the character in Creature Commandos, and he’ll appear in live-action for James Gunn’s 2025 Superman movie.

Character: Leo Barnes is the main protagonist of The Purge: Anarchy and The Purge: Election Year. He’s a former LAPD Police Sergeant who’s now Charlie Roan’s head of security.

Elizabeth Mitchell as Senator Charlie Roan

Born March 27, 1970

  • Active Since: 1992

Actor: Elizabeth Mitchell is an American actress who’s best known for her Emmy-nominated role as Juliet in Lost, which is widely regarded as one of the best TV shows of all time. Mitchell began working over a decade before appearing on Lost, but she’s found more career success after the fact. She’s had roles on popular TV shows like ER, Once Upon a Time, The Expanse, and Outer Banks, as well as a main role in Tim Allen’s The Santa Clauses movie and expanded TV series.

Character: Senator Charlie Roan is a presidential candidate taking a harsh stance against the Purge.

Betty Gabriel as Laney Rucker

Born January 6, 1981

  • Active Since: 2004

Actor: Betty Gabriel is an American actress from Washington, D.C., who’s best known for her roles in horror films like The Purge: Election Year and Get Out. She had several minor roles before finding career success with The Purge sequel, which allowed her to find parts on prominent TV shows like Westworld and Jordan Peele’s The Twilight Zone. She’s also been in shows like Clickbait, Tom Clancy’s Jack Ryan, and Manhunt. In 2025, she can be seen in the movie Novocaine, starring Jack Quaid.

Character: Laney is an EMT and former purger who ends up joining with Leo’s team.

Mykelti Williamson as Joe Dixon

Born March 4, 1957


Mykelti Williamson

  • Active Since: 1978

Actor: Mykelti Williamson is an American actor from St. Louis, Missouri, who’s best known for his role as Bubba Blue in 1994’s Best Picture-winning movie Forrest Gump. He’s continued to appear in supporting roles in various movies and shows since, including Michael Mann’s crime epic, Heat, The Final Destination, Ali, and Denzel Washington’s Fences. In 2024, he appeared in an episode of Prime Video’s successful video game adaptation, Fallout, and he’s also had guest roles in dozens of well-known network dramas like Hawaii Five-0 and Chicago P.D.

Character: Joe is a bodega owner who joins Leo’s team during Purge night.

The Purge: Election Year Supporting Cast & Characters

Terry Serpico as Earl Danzinger: Terry Serpico is an American actor who’s appeared in various movies and TV shows since the ’90s, including Donnie Brasco, The Departed, Michael Clayton, and Hannibal.

Edwin Hodge as Dante Bishop: Edwin Hodge is an American actor best known for his role as the Bloody Stranger, Dante Bishop, in the first three Purge films.

Kyle Secor as Minister Edwidge Owens: Kyle Secor has acted in films and shows since the late 1980s, including The Flash, American Horror Story, and many more.

Joseph Julian Soria: Joseph Julian Soria is an American actor best known for his role in the Lifetime series Army Wives. He’s also been in movies like Fast & Furious and shows like Dexter.
